CHANGELOG — AgriLink Gateway v4.2

Changed defaults for the telemetry gateway shipping with Harrowfield combines. Batch upload interval shortened, offline buffer enlarged, and GPS sampling now adaptive under canopy. Field trials at the Drensmoor test farm showed a 40% drop in dropped packets. Existing installs keep old values until re-provisioned; new flashes pick these up automatically. Raise concerns at sync before Thursday's firmware cut. The new default configuration is as follows.

config for kafof-bawef:
holath:
  log_level: debug
  metrics_host: metrics.holath.qorvelsys.internal
  pin: 2191
  pool_size: 32

// Workaround for the Sellwyn session-token refresh bug (tracked
// internally as the "double-refresh" incident). The Sellwyn auth
// service occasionally invalidates a token mid-refresh, so this
// client retries exactly once with a fresh handshake before
// surfacing an error. If you are on call and see repeated 401s
// despite the retry, restart the token broker pod — do not bump
// the retry count, it makes the race worse.
// This client authenticates to the broker using the key that follows.

service key, kawif-yahig: zpat11_2yR07ZhXO2n

## Releases

Pixelbarrow 3.4 fixes the image-cache leak: decoded bitmaps were retained by the eviction listener after cache teardown. Plugin authors relying on the old listener lifecycle must update to the weak-reference API; the strong-reference hooks are removed. No other behavioral changes. Upgrade before 3.5, when compatibility shims drop. Verify your plugin against the leak-check harness in the SDK before publishing. All plugin packages must be signed for the Pixelbarrow registry. The signing key follows.

deploy key for kajof-fajop: bky6_gDHw9Q